1. I could point at the characters, animation, and so on, but really, I just like how utterly sincere the whole thing is. I mean, I'm usually not a big fan of the saccharine happy-fest type show, because I always get a feeling of "the writers just put this in because the studio told them to", but when I watch MLP, they say everything with a totally straight face. Be kind to others. Don't betray your friends. Generally, acting like a dick isn't cool.
While all of these sound completely obvious, so many times in media we see the douchebags get the pot of gold while the people who decide to do the right thing or be overall nice people are seen as the suckers. I mean, I have nothing against dark and gritty, but there is such thing as over-saturation.
Watching MLP just puts a smile on my face every time, so I come back to it whenever I'm feeling down.
